White Bean Spread – Speed It Up

This is a super fast recipe and therefore great when you’re in a rush. The reason we write to fry the onions first is that recently all the ones we bought have been a little on the harsh side.

If your onions aren’t overly strong or overpowering, you can skip that step completely.

The same holds true for the garlic – it’s delicious when used fresh and unfried.

But it’s also delicious fried too, so if you fry the onions, you may as well chuck the garlic in with them as well.
The nutrition card shown here is using fried onions and garlic, and is based on two people sharing the spread as snack. Enjoy!

Quick White Bean Spread (vegan pâté)

Quick White Bean Spread (vegan pâté). A super fast recipe that works as an appetizer, snack or party dip. Surprise your guests with this awesome spread!

Cuisine:Vegan

Diet: dairy-free, egg-free, gluten-free, vegan

Servings:2 people

Calories:327kcal

Author: HurryTheFoodUp

Ingredients

  • 1 medium onion
  • 1 clove garlic
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 can white beans (1 can = 15.5 oz)
  • ¼ cup sun dried tomatoes in oil
  • ½ lemon (juiced)
  • 2 tbsp parsley, fresh (or frozen, chopped, use less if dried)
  • 2 tbsp chives, fresh (or frozen, chopped)
  • 1 tbsp water
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Optional

  • 2 tbsp tomato puree (The recipe above has a dark, almost nutty flavour. If you like your patè a little sweeter then add some puree for this effect.)
  • Worcestershire sauce (vegetarian) (A few drops also combine nicely with this. Make sure you grab an anchovy-free, vegan one)

Instructions

  • Roughly chop the onion and garlic.

  • Fry them in oil for a couple of minutes until lightly browned. When ready, throw both into a large mixing bowl.

  • Drain and rinse the beans and place them in the bowl.

  • Juice the lemon.

  • Finally, add the lemon juice and rest of the ingredients and using a hand blender, give it all a good blend. Alternatively throw it all in a food processor instead. That’s it! Serve as you like, hot wholemeal bread goes great.
